Mortgage Loan Application Detail Totals for Culebra County PR in 2003

Loan Purpose

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Home Purchase (one-to-four family) 72 $10,911,000 $151,000 $351,000 $142,000 $714,000
Refinancing (home purchase or home improvement, one-to-four family) 55 $5,355,000 $97,000 $960,000 $74,000 $800,000
Home Improvement (one-to-four family) 35 $474,000 $13,000 $57,000 $24,000 $78,000
Multifamily dwelling (home purchase, home improvement, and refinancings) 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0

Applicant Race

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Hispanic 143 $15,069,000 $105,000 $960,000 $90,000 $800,000
Not applicable 9 $1,215,000 $135,000 $317,000 $64,000 $343,000
Information not provided by applicant in mail or telephone application 6 $49,000 $8,000 $20,000 $28,000 $51,000
White 4 $407,000 $101,000 $240,000 $58,000 $99,000
Other 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
American Indian or Alaskan Native 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
Asian or Pacific Islander 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
Black 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0

Loan Type

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Conventional (any loan other than FHA, VA, FSA, or RHS loans) 159 $16,536,000 $104,000 $960,000 $88,000 $800,000
FHA-insured (Federal Housing Administration) 2 $157,000 $78,000 $79,000 $10,000 $20,000
FSA/RHS (Farm Service Agency or Rural Housing Service) 1 $47,000 $47,000 $47,000 $24,000 $24,000
VA-guaranteed (Veterans Administration) 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0

Outcome

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Loan Originated 88 $12,580,000 $142,000 $960,000 $126,000 $800,000
Application Denied By Financial Institution 36 $718,000 $19,000 $162,000 $44,000 $401,000
Loan Purchased By The Institution 15 $1,524,000 $101,000 $351,000 $60,000 $701,000
Application Withdrawn By Applicant 10 $496,000 $49,000 $103,000 $36,000 $90,000
File Closed For Incompleteness 7 $791,000 $113,000 $200,000 $94,000 $203,000
Application Approved But Not Accepted 6 $631,000 $105,000 $159,000 $89,000 $126,000

Denial Reason

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Credit History 10 $162,000 $16,000 $60,000 $20,000 $51,000
Debt-To-Income Ratio 5 $47,000 $9,000 $20,000 $19,000 $50,000
Other 3 $47,000 $15,000 $30,000 $48,000 $78,000
Unverifiable Information 1 $35,000 $35,000 $35,000 $40,000 $40,000
Collateral 1 $60,000 $60,000 $60,000 $22,000 $22,000
Credit Application Incomplete 1 $10,000 $10,000 $10,000 $19,000 $19,000
Employment History 1 $10,000 $10,000 $10,000 $17,000 $17,000
Insufficient Cash (Downpayment, Closing Cost) 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
Mortgage Insurance Denied 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
